96 Explorer won't start Occasionally!

I have an odd problem where my explorer will not start every so often. For example, it will not even turnover. Feels like no fuel is pushing through. We then wait awhile and it starts fine and doesn't happen again for awhile. But the last 2 days it has done it on my wife and the 1st time took 10 minutes of sitting there till it started but it happened again and it took over an hour to get started.

What does "it will not even turnover" mean? When you turn the key to the start position, does the engine crank over? Or are you sayng it will crank, but not run?

If it will crank but not start, there are ways to troubleshoot the problem. The engine needs three things to start: compression, proper air/fuel mixture getting to the cylinders, and spark at the right time. Troubleshooting will help determine where the problem is. If the ignition is delivering spark at the proper time, and the engine sounds like it always did when cranking before the problem started, then the problem is probably in the fuel system. A compression check will show the state of the compression. :-\ Elimination of the compression and ignition will usually point to the remaining factor: the fuel system. Troubleshooting isn't that difficult for major failures like a failure to start.

It's the little things that can drive a mechanic nuts, especially intermittant electrical problems. :-(

I'm not quite sure what symptoms you are describing. Is the starter motor turning? Do you hear a click when you turn the key to Start? Sometimes a starter motor will be intermittant if the brushes are just about worn out.

Hello I have a 94 explorer and my friend has a 95 and we both had this trouble a shop can not tell you what the problem is because they can only test the truck if it wont start I took mine in and it started for them so it could not be checked this was happing to me what the problem is under the hood on the passager side fender there is a black box lift the over up and this is relays in there the next time it wont start (just turns over but sounds like its not getting gas) turn your key on and lift your hood go to thje relays and move them side to side it should the the middle relay on the right side of thr box and you will here it click on.To fix this take the to bolds out that tolds the relay box pull the box out and use a screw driver to pull the connectors out a little so that it make a good connection let me know if this helps Mike
